philrogers wrote:The problem with a sample is that the results depend very much on where the sample was taken.
For instance if the sample was taken from an online community that exists for Cardiff City fans you might get one set of results, if it was taken from a portion of the fans who attended a Cardiff City home game you might get a different set of results and a survey of people attending a Cardiff City away game may give differing results again.
The other issue is that the sample needs to be representative of the fan base, so taking a survey of fans in the pub would not necessarily work very well.
Basically as the old adage goes "there are lies, damned lies and statistics". As somebody who worked with Statisticians for quite a few years I can absolutely vouch for that!
